在没有 link 的情况下向 wordpress 添加管理菜单
Add an admin menu to wordpress without link
我想给 wordpress admin 添加一个带有 ID 的菜单,也就是说,没有 link。我想添加它以激活我将添加的 modal/popup。我可以放置一个浮动按钮,但我想让它更有条理。
创建菜单的方法如下:https://developer.wordpress.org/reference/functions/add_menu_page/
我不知道如何让它只有图标、名称和 ID,没有重定向 link。
您可以像这样连接到全局 $menu
add_action( 'admin_menu' , 'admin_menu_custom_menu' );
function admin_menu_custom_menu() {
global $menu;
$menu[20] = array( 'Menu item name', 'manage_options' , 'http://example.com', '', 'classname', '', 'dashicons name or link to image' );
}
只要确保 $menu[20] 不存在,否则它会被覆盖。
我想给 wordpress admin 添加一个带有 ID 的菜单,也就是说,没有 link。我想添加它以激活我将添加的 modal/popup。我可以放置一个浮动按钮,但我想让它更有条理。
创建菜单的方法如下:https://developer.wordpress.org/reference/functions/add_menu_page/
我不知道如何让它只有图标、名称和 ID,没有重定向 link。
您可以像这样连接到全局 $menu
add_action( 'admin_menu' , 'admin_menu_custom_menu' );
function admin_menu_custom_menu() {
global $menu;
$menu[20] = array( 'Menu item name', 'manage_options' , 'http://example.com', '', 'classname', '', 'dashicons name or link to image' );
}
只要确保 $menu[20] 不存在,否则它会被覆盖。